Position: Lead Electronics Engineer 
Location: Tampa Bay Area Position Overview: Our client is currently looking for a Lead Power Electronics Engineer in the Tampa Bay area. As a Lead Power Electronics Engineer, you will play a pivotal role in the design and development of cutting-edge electronic systems. Leveraging your expertise in power electronics, you will collaborate closely with cross-functional teams to bring innovative solutions to fruition.
Key Responsibilities:
Utilize a strong background in power electronics to design electronic circuits. Collaborate with Electrical Engineers and Principal Architects to gain comprehensive understanding of design requirements. Partner with Project Manager to provide accurate quotes for projects. Demonstrate leadership by overseeing and guiding the Electrical Engineering team. Execute circuit and schematic design, including component selection and layout of analog and digital embedded systems. Utilize computer-assisted engineering/design software and equipment to optimize designs. Foster and manage relationships with electronics vendors and contract manufacturers. Lead design reviews to ensure compliance with project objectives and industry best practices. Qualifications:
Bachelor's degree in Electrical Engineering. Minimum of 5 years of relevant experience in electrical hardware, including experience in designing electrical systems and leading tasks or managing tasks individually. Strong background in power electronics, including proficiency in AC/DC, DC/AC, and DC/DC power conversion, DC/DC power supply, grid-connected inverters (3-level and 5-level), and energy storage. Experience in writing and designing to specifications, as well as creating test plans. Proficiency with Ansys and Cadence Simulation Tools. Expertise in embedded systems, processor selection, various communication protocols, analog design, sensor design, low power design, audio technologies, and display.
